Output 679280191c97f6b397735e32dee2ec00307a94b7dcbbd8bad1fa3a285ae21223:1

value
12566650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18c9391f477a87d74505e3e2f1e9c4c91537601f OP_EQUALVERIFY OP_CHECKSIG
address
13G4GqH3WrDwGcwLsKXKrUMnCGXsprzCa5
transaction
679280191c97f6b397735e32dee2ec00307a94b7dcbbd8bad1fa3a285ae21223
confirmations
405322
spent
true